What Affects Rates in Joliet
- I-80 and I-55 Accident Density: Joliet sits at the intersection of I-80 and I-55, two of Illinois' highest-traffic commercial corridors. High-risk drivers in this zone face elevated premiums due to increased accident frequency and severity claims tied to heavy truck traffic and congestion near interchanges.
- Will County Court Traffic Volume: Will County Circuit Court processes a high volume of traffic violations and DUI cases from Joliet and surrounding suburbs. Drivers with multiple violations or court-supervised releases often face non-standard carrier placement, raising premiums 40–80% above standard market rates.
- Chicago Metro Uninsured Driver Concentration: The broader Chicago metro area, including Will County, has elevated uninsured motorist rates compared to downstate Illinois. High-risk drivers should prioritize uninsured motorist coverage, as collision with an uninsured driver can trigger another at-fault claim on your record if you lack protection.
- Winter Weather and Multi-Vehicle Incidents: Joliet experiences significant snowfall and ice events each winter, contributing to multi-vehicle pileups on I-80 and local arterials. Drivers with existing violations who add a winter at-fault accident often see rate increases of 50–70%, and some carriers non-renew after a second incident.
